Help Setting up MySQL ODBC Driver for Cystal Reports
I am very new to MySQL and Crystal Reports, and I am having difficulty setting up the MySQL ODBC 3.51 Driver to use with Crystal Reports. The problem that I am having is, the MySQL server that I am using is currently housed on a separate server, so I am required to log into the server before I log into MySQL. When I attempt to setup the data source, there does not seem to be any area to enter login prompts before logging into MySQL. Here are the steps that I use currently to login into MySQL:
-Telnet to the server
-Login to the server with my user id and password
-Enter the command mysql -u username -p
-Then I am prompted for the password
-Specify the schema by the Use command
It seems that I can only enter the server, username, password, and database, when setting up the data source, so the connection always fails.
Is there anyway to address this, or is this not possible?
